In terms of removing certain parts of the caliper, you’ll want to begin by removing the retainer clip. You can then proceed to cover the bleeder valve with masking tape to ensure that it’s completely covered. If you are capable of removing a caliper, it may be easier for you to paint the caliper with it removed from the car. This allows you to avoid the time consuming task of covering any exposed areas as well as cleaning and painting the caliper in a comfortable location i.e. a work’s table. Once the paint is completely dry, you can proceed to reinstall the wheels on to the car. When installing the wheels, make sure that you use a torque wrench to tighten the wheels to the correct torque specs and avoid hitting the caliper. Once installed, you can then lower the car and inspect the final finish with the calipers behind the wheel. Unlike other areas of your car, the brakes produce a lot of heat under heavy braking. Therefore it’s important that you use a brake caliper paint that’s designed to cope with the heat and harsh contaminants such as brake dust. Yes, our standard range is suitable for both spray and brush painting and full instructions are provided. Baking the calipers at 60c for around 45 minutes is ideal where the facilities are available. However, you really don’t need to worry if you don’t or can’t bake your calipers after spraying or brush painting them. A. Yes, but you must use standard thinners only and we don’t recommend using thinners if you are brushing the product. In our pro kits, we supply enough thinners for our heat resistant base coat. But if you’re spraying our brake caliper paint from a spray gun, just add ‘to taste’ so to speak so you are happy with how it’s coming out the nozzle. Use a minimum 1.2mm nozzle and an absolute max of 1.8mm, but you’ll need to turn your feed down. A. Yes. But don’t use anything more coarse than 1200 grit wet and dry and be careful on edges, if machine polishing with a handheld polisher, you should mask sharp/hard edges.
